The regional center, Irkutsk, was founded as a fort in 1661 and became a major trade post connecting Russia with Asia.

Major development occurred in the 20th century with the construction of massive hydroelectric power stations in cities like Bratsk and Ust-Ilimsk , fueling aluminum and woodworking industries. Economy and Infrastructure
